Location problems. In a directed G = (N, A) with arc lengths cij, we define the distance between a pair of nodes i and j as the length of the shortest path from node i to node j.
(a) Define the radial distance from node i as the length of the distance from node i to the node farthest from it. We say that a node p is a center of the graph G if node p has as small a radial distance as any node in the network. Suggest a straightforward polynomial-time algorithm for identifying a center of G.
(b) Define the star distance of node i as the total distance from node i to all the nodes in the network. We refer to a node q as a median of G if node q has as small a star distance as any node in the network. Suggest a straightforward polynomial-time algorithm for identifying a median of G.
